2013-05-22 78 views
1

在.NET 4.5,我使用HttpRequestMessage什麼HttpRequestMessage相當於在.NET 4.0中

public HttpResponseMessage Post(HttpRequestMessage request, TourCreateRequest tourCreateRequest) 

我可以使用.NET 4.0,我可以使用同樣有機會獲得請求頭,身體,用於調用呼叫的URL,客戶端證書以及許多其他有價值的屬性。謝謝。

回答

4

也可以在.net 4中使用HttpRequestMessage。

+0

是的,我終於設法弄清楚了。添加了對System.Net.Http和System.Net.Http.WebRequest的引用。謝謝。 – jaxxbo

0

您應該檢出HttpWebRequest

它可以用來代替HttpClient做出請求(和處理所有的其他功能在您的文章)。

+0

我沒有使用HttpClient。在post操作中,我需要獲取所有請求的詳細信息.....正在嘗試如何獲取..... – jaxxbo

+0

@jaxxbo - HttpResponseMessage和HttpRequestMessage都被HttpClient使用(無論是明確的還是幕後的)做出實際的要求。 4.5之前,最簡單的方法是使用HttpWebRequest。所有來自HttpResponseMessage/HttpRequestMessage的數據都可以在HttpWebRequest實例中找到。 –